Myself Ajay from Metallurgical Engineering background at JNTUH Hyderabad. I got selected for Vedanta Resources through a campus interview on campus. I want to share my experience with you all.
Selection took place in 4 stages:
1. Tough Eligibility Criteria.
2. Written Test.
3. G.D.
4. Technical and HR Interview.
Package : (5.5 lpa fixed+2.5 lpa allowances).
Written test: ( "marking and offline paper).
Consists of 35 questions from 31-33 from aptitude, and 2-3 questions from GK. The overall range of the test is medium. The time limit is only 45 minutes.
Out of 200 students from the below disciplines, only 14 from each branch were shortlisted for the next GD.
GD:
The time limit is only 10 minutes. Our topic was "Reservation system in India.
Out of 14 from my branch, only 10 were shortlisted for the technical round.
Remember you need to speak at least for 1-2 minutes to be shortlisted.
No matter you don't have to know the topic, you have to speak.
Technical and HR:
It's much of technical rather than HR. (focus is more on technical knowledge).
A few Technical questions from metallurgy are:
Draw Fe-Fe3C and explain the phases.
Explain the difference between GCI and Nodular cast irons. etc.,
Focus on the non-ferrous extraction of metals such as Al, Cu, Zn, Ag and production processes.
A project/summer internship was asked. So, be thorough with your project.
A few HR questions were included during this process.
Out of 10 members, 5 members were finalised for the Vedanta Resources from Metallurgy JNTUH.
Only 2 from Mechanical, 3 from Chemical and 1 from electrical got selected.
Original mark sheet, 10th, 12th certificate verification done by HR people.
After successful completion. You will get the offer letter on the same day.
The place of posting will be informed by them soon.
